一、先用apt-get安装一个低版本gcc
? ? sudo apt-get install gcc-4.4 g++-4.4 gfortran-4.4
? ? matlab2012a可以支持到最高为4.4版本的gcc,而ubuntu14.04默认的gcc版本为4.8
二、修改mexopts.sh
? ? sudo vi /opt/MATLAB/R2012a/bin/mexopts.sh
? ? 将所有的gcc、g++、gfortran出现分别替换成gcc-4.4、g++-4.4、gfortran-4.4
? ? 将CFLAGS='-ansi -D_GNU_SOURCE'改为CFLAGS='-std=c99 -D_GNU_SOURCE'以支持//风格注释
三、启动matlab执行mex -setup命令
>> mex -setup

四、测试
(1)进入matlab工作目录,并创建源文件hello1.c内容如下:
#include "mex.h"
void mexFunction(int nlhs, mxArray *plhs[], int nrhs, const mxArray *prhs[])
{
? ? int i;
? ? i=mxGetScalar(prhs[0]);
? ? if(i==1)
? ? ? ? mexPrintf("hello,world!\n");
? ? else
? ? ? ? mexPrintf("大家好!\n");
}
?
>> mex hello1.c
>> hello1(0)
大家好!
>> hello1(1)
hello,world!
mexFunction 输入参数含义
int? nlhs :输出 参数的 个数
mxArray? *? plhs :输出参数的 mxArray数组
int? nrhs :输入 参数的 个数
mxArray? *? prhs: 输入参数的 mxArray 数组
